Are people in Kendallville older or younger than people in Bridgeport?- The Median Age in Kendallville is 6.4 years older than in Bridgeport.
Are housing costs cheaper in Kendallville or Bridgeport?- Kendallville
housing costs are 18.5% more expensive than Bridgeport hous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Kendallville or Bridgeport?- The average commute for residents of Kendallville is 0.3 minutes longer than it is for residents of Bridgeport.
